骨膜素在主动脉瓣退行性变中的表达及其意义  被引量:1

Distribution characteristic and pathologic role of periostin in degenerative aortic valve

摘  要:目的检验骨膜素在退行性变主动脉瓣中的表达以及其病理作用。方法连续收集接受瓣膜置换术患者的退行性主动脉瓣标本24例(男13例,女11例),取同期Bentall手术切除的正常主动脉瓣膜标本5例作为对照。组织切片常规苏木素-伊红(HE)染色观察瓣膜结构。采用免疫组织化学分析方法对瓣膜中骨膜素及血管内皮生长因子(VEGF)的表达进行比较分析。同时对冰冻标本进行Western blot检测,进一步验证相应分子表达水平组间差异。结果退行性主动脉瓣出现结构破坏、微血管增生、钙化等表现。与正常瓣膜比较,骨膜素在退行性主动瓣膜中表达增高(0.009±0.006比0.041±0.024,P=0.001),集中表达钙化坏死区域、血管形成区域。VEGF在病变瓣膜中表达增高(0.007±0.011比0.021±0.005,P=0.002),两者呈线性相关(r=0.458,P=0.012)。结论骨膜素参与瓣膜细胞外基质增生,组织重构及新生血管形成,促进了主动脉瓣退行性变。ObjectiveTo determine the expression pattern and pathologic role of periostin in degenerative aortic valve.MethodsTwenty-four degenerative aortic valve specimens were obtained during surgery for aortic valve replacement (13 males and 11 females). Five normal samples from patients undergoing Bentall procedure for acute type A aortic dissection served as controls. Histological sections from each sample were prepared and stained with haematoxylin-eosin (HE) for microscopy. Immunohistochemistry (IHC) was performed to assess the expression and localization of periostin and VEGF, respectively. Western blotting analysis was performed to determine the periostin and VEGF level in fresh-frozen valvular tissues.ResultsThe degenerative aortic valve presents the phenotypes of disorganization, infiltration of microvascular, and atherogenic calcification. Compared to the controls, the expression of periostin was strikingly elevated in diseased valves, average absorbance value (IA) was 0.009±0.006 vs. 0.041±0.024 (P=0.001), which concentrated in calcification and perivascular area. VEGF expression was also increasing in diseased valves, IA was 0.007±0.011 vs. 0.021±0.005 (P=0.002), the levels of the two proteins were linear correlated (r=0.458, P=0.012).ConclusionPeriostin participates in reorganization of extracellular matrix and the angiogenesis in degenerative aortic valves. It promotes the degenerative process of aortic valve.
